School Occupational Therapist - Marana, Arizona
Job Description
Embark on a rewarding opportunity as an Occupational Therapist supporting students across multiple sites in the Marana area. This part-time, 0.6 FTE itinerant position is ideal for professionals eager to make a positive impact by providing critical OT services to students with a range of needs, from mild to severe. The role offers a dynamic work environment working at a few different locations, ensuring every day brings new challenges and chances to support student growth and development.
Key Qualifications and Experience:
- Active Occupational Therapy license required
- Preferred initial certification by the National Board for Certification of Occupational Therapy (NBCOT)
- Valid IVP Fingerprint Card required
- Previous experience working in school-based settings is highly valued
- Strong adaptability and communication skills
- Ability to travel between multiple school sites as part of an itinerant schedule
Responsibilities:
- Assess and provide therapy for students with diverse needs, ranging from mild to severe
- Develop, implement, and monitor individualized treatment plans
- Collaborate with teachers, staff, and families to support students’ access to educational opportunities
- Participate in IEP meetings, documentation, and progress reporting
- Adapt interventions as needed to maximize student participation in school settings
